We love toys that foster creativity and independent play, and the Melissa & Doug Play Kitchen certainly fits the bill! Gummy Lump sent us this gorgeous kitchen for my girls to try out, and I’ve been regularly “dining” on homecooked gourmet lunches and snacks courtesy of my two daughters ever since.

The Melissa & Doug Play Kitchen is very sturdy and spacious, and I love the bright colors and design, especially the retro cherries. It was shipped in two separate (very heavy) boxes, but it only took my husband about an hour to put it together. I suspect it probably would have only taken half the time if he’d had a little less “help.” You know the saying about too many cooks…
